The match between CD Universidad Católica Santiago and Everton Viña del Mar ended in a resounding 6-0 victory for the home team, which was a showcase of offensive dominance and strategic execution. Universidad Católica demonstrated exceptional teamwork and efficient ball movement, resulting in a blitz of goals scored at periodic intervals throughout the match. The high scoring started early in the first half and was sustained with relentless pressure into the second half, indicative of a highly disciplined and well-coordinated attacking side.

Statistically, Universidad Católica's ability to convert offensive opportunities was noticeably superior. With 8 corner kicks compared to Everton's 5, the home team maximized these set-piece opportunities efficiently, maintaining high pressure on the visitors' defense. The breakdown in Everton's defense was compounded by their inability to recover possession effectively and deal with the persistent threats posed by the home team, leading to an overwhelming number of goals conceded.

Discipline and defensive organization played a crucial role in this contest. Although Universidad Católica received three yellow cards, their structured defensive strategy ensured there were no lapses leading to red cards or dangerous free kicks. In contrast, Everton's single yellow card did little to stabilize a defense under continuous siege. The home side managed to balance aggressive play without crossing disciplinary lines, maintaining their tactical shape throughout the match while capitalizing on Everton's mistakes.
